Asbestos trust funds

The mesothelioma trust funds allow patients and their families to access money from asbestos companies in bankruptcy, which exposed people to this disease. The funds can be used to pay for mesothelioma therapy funeral costs, and other expenses. To determine if asbestos-related victims are eligible for asbestos trust payments, they should consult an experienced mesothelioma lawyer.

Mesothelioma is a rare and fatal disease caused by exposure to asbestos. Many companies were aware of asbestos' dangers, but continued to use it in their products because it was cheap and heat-resistant. In the end millions of workers were exposed to asbestos and were diagnosed with serious asbestos-related illnesses.

Asbestos trusts were created to pay mesothelioma sufferers and their families for the loss of income and funeral expenses, medical bills and suffering and pain. The trust funds are administered by the bankruptcy court, and are overseen by an independent trustee. It is complicated to make an appeal for compensation and get it from these trusts. Victims should speak with mesothelioma lawyers.

Legal professionals are aware of the laws of each state and national regulations to ensure that the claim is filed properly. They'll also be able to collect the evidence needed, such as medical records, work background and asbestos exposure information. Mesothelioma lawyers can also conduct interviews with employees and employers to gather more information.

After the claim has been filed the claim will be reviewed for approval by an asbestos trust trustee. The trustees will assign the claim a value based on an established schedule that will take into account the kind of asbestos-related diseases identified. They can also decide to conduct an individual review, which allows them to take a closer look at the unique facts of each case.

Compensation amounts for asbestos trust claims were determined prior to the setting of rates, also known as percentages of payment were applied. These percentages were set to ensure that asbestos trusts would not run out money to pay future victims. The exact amount that a victim receives will depend on their particular asbestos diagnosis as well as their employment history and other factors.

VA benefits

Mesothelioma compensation claims assist patients and their families pay for treatment costs as well as living expenses, among others. Compensation also assists victims in holding asbestos companies accountable for their actions. Making a claim can be difficult and time-consuming. Many patients rely on mesothelioma lawyers to help them win their case and file it.

In addition to the compensation received from lawsuits, trust funds and settlements, those diagnosed with mesothelioma could be eligible for VA benefits. Veterans and their spouses, children, and heirs are eligible for these benefits. These programs pay for mesothelioma treatment as well as help pay for travel to specialist treatments, and offer home healthcare services.

A mesothelioma cancer of veterans VA benefit depends on their military branch and history. The amount of compensation can vary from a monthly disability benefit to a lifetime healthcare insurance. A lawyer can help determine the most beneficial benefit for every situation.

Veterans need to prove that exposure to asbestos caused their illness in order to be eligible to receive compensation from the VA. This can be difficult because the asbestos companies who exposed veterans to dangerous products are now bankrupt. A lawyer can help patients and their families gather relevant documents to support the claim.

Veterans can avail VA health benefits, which include access to mesothelioma experts at one of the best mesothelioma clinics in the United States, depending on their asbestos diagnosis. If a veteran doesn't reside near one of these facilities, they may request their VA doctor to refer them to a civilian mesothelioma specialist. This will enable the veteran to receive the treatment they require without having to travel long distances.

The VA also offers home healthcare and a caregiver benefit, referred to as Aid and Attendance (A&A). A&A is intended to assist veterans with their daily tasks like bathing, dressing and eating. It may also cover the cost of an individual nurse. Veterans who require assistance with their daily activities must contact their VA case worker to inquire about the benefits available to them.
